Transaction e18403966a2f6895f00afa9e6efd77e699d48dc1cc50d9dc49a22f40a6876311
1 Input
1 Output
-
e18403966a2f6895f00afa9e6efd77e699d48dc1cc50d9dc49a22f40a6876311:0
- value
- 47482
- script pubkey
- OP_0 OP_PUSHBYTES_32 55c7b39170fde0a9e77fc67a74268d61e3ddafcccbc27bde66d72698034c1e25
- address
- bc1q2hrm8ytslhs2nemlcea8gf5dv83amt7ve0p8hhnx6unfsq6vrcjsx8wud9